Cheapest and Most Expensive Time to Visit Dubai

Discover the cheapest time to go to Dubai, when it’s most expensive, and the best time to visit this over the top city in the UAE.

Cheapest and Most Expensive Time to Visit Dubai
Museum of the Future Building In Dubai With Arabic Calligraphy

The cheapest and most expensive times to visit Dubai will vary based on weather, demand, and holiday periods. Knowing when to go—and when not to—can help you save hundreds or avoid traveling when it’s unbearably hot or overcrowded.

Here’s a complete breakdown of Dubai's seasonal travel costs, highlighting off-season, peak season, and shoulder season, and what to expect during each time of year.


Cheapest Time to Visit Dubai

The cheapest time to visit Dubai is during the summer months, especially from June through August. This is the city’s off-season, when daytime temperatures can soar well above 105°F (40°C), and humidity levels stay high.

Tourism drops significantly during this time, which leads to major discounts on hotels, tours, and indoor attractions like Burj Khalifa, Dubai Mall, and Aquaventure Waterpark. If you're okay with staying indoors most of the day and exploring early in the morning or at night, this is when you'll get the best deals.

Dubai's Off Season Highlights:

  • Lowest hotel and resort rates of the year
  • Big discounts at malls, restaurants, and indoor attractions
  • Fewer tourists at landmarks and sightseeing spots
  • Great time for budget luxury travel

Most Expensive Time to Visit Dubai

The most expensive time to visit Dubai is during the winter months, from December through February, when temperatures are pleasant and outdoor events are in full swing. This is Dubai’s peak season, and it attracts tourists from around the world.

Hotel prices spike—especially around Christmas, New Year’s, and Dubai Shopping Festival. Beaches, souks, and entertainment venues get crowded, and bookings for tours, safaris, and restaurants should be made well in advance.

Dubai's Peak Season Highlights:

  • Ideal weather for beaches, outdoor dining, and desert safaris
  • Major events, festivals, and concerts throughout the city
  • Best time for visiting theme parks and rooftop lounges
  • Everything running at full capacity for tourists

Best Time to Visit Dubai on a Budget

The best time to visit Dubai if you're on a budget is going to be during the shoulder months, especially late April to early June and late September to early November. These periods offer a great mix of affordable prices and bearable weather—before the extreme summer heat or winter crowds kick in.

You’ll still get plenty of sunshine with slightly cooler temperatures, making it a smart time to enjoy Dubai’s beaches, shopping, and desert activities—without risking your trip being ruined by overwhelming heat of the low season or the high prices of peak season which has the coolest temps.

Shoulder Season Highlights:

  • More affordable hotel and flight options
  • Manageable weather for outdoor sightseeing
  • Fewer crowds at major attractions and beaches
  • Great time to explore the city at a slower pace

Not A Member? ✈️

Save 40%-95% On Flights With Jetsetter Alerts Airline Mistake Fare & Flash Sales Alerts!

Get Personalized Airfare Alerts

Airline Mistake Fares